Biggs Highlights MAGA Gains and Vision for Arizona's Future

During an interview, Representative Andy Biggs from Arizona expressed that the global political landscape is shifting in favor of the MAGA movement, which he attributed as a significant achievement of the Trump administration. He noted that several European countries are moving towards conservative policies, which he finds remarkable. Biggs highlighted a lesser-known success: a budget surplus reported in June, contrasting with previous deficits. He remarked on the current economic situation where inflation is low and tariffs are seemingly effective, leading to confusion among economists.

As Biggs prepares to leave Congress to run for governor of Arizona, he shared his vision for the state. He hopes to create an environment where residents can thrive and fulfill their potential. He emphasized the importance of strong public safety, a robust economy with job opportunities, quality education, and essential infrastructure like water and power. Biggs believes that government should take a step back to allow markets to function effectively so individuals can pursue their goals as they see fit.
